当前位置:首页 > 科技 > 正文

调度算法与力的合成:一场看不见的较量

  • 科技
  • 2026-01-02 05:36:20
  • 2175
摘要: 在现代科技的舞台上,调度算法与力的合成如同两位隐秘的舞者,各自在不同的领域中演绎着自己的精彩。它们看似毫不相干,实则在某些方面有着惊人的相似之处。本文将带你走进这场看不见的较量,探索它们之间的微妙联系,以及它们如何在各自的领域中发挥着不可替代的作用。# 一...

在现代科技的舞台上,调度算法与力的合成如同两位隐秘的舞者,各自在不同的领域中演绎着自己的精彩。它们看似毫不相干,实则在某些方面有着惊人的相似之处。本文将带你走进这场看不见的较量,探索它们之间的微妙联系,以及它们如何在各自的领域中发挥着不可替代的作用。

# 一、调度算法:时间的编排者

调度算法,顾名思义,就是一种用于安排任务执行顺序的算法。它广泛应用于计算机科学、操作系统、网络通信等领域,其核心目标是高效地利用资源,以最小化等待时间和最大化系统吞吐量。想象一下,调度算法就像是一个时间的编排者,它需要考虑各种因素,如任务的优先级、资源的可用性、时间的紧迫性等,来决定何时执行哪些任务。

在计算机系统中,调度算法可以分为多种类型,如优先级调度、时间片轮转、短作业优先等。每种算法都有其独特的应用场景和优势。例如,优先级调度算法适用于需要快速响应的关键任务,而时间片轮转算法则适用于多用户交互系统,确保每个用户都能获得一定的CPU时间。这些算法不仅需要考虑当前的任务状态,还需要预测未来可能出现的任务,从而做出最优的决策。

# 二、力的合成:物理世界的编排者

调度算法与力的合成:一场看不见的较量

调度算法与力的合成:一场看不见的较量

力的合成是物理学中的一个重要概念,它描述了多个力作用于一个物体时,如何将这些力合并为一个等效的合力。在物理学中,力的合成遵循矢量加法的原则,即可以通过几何方法或解析方法来计算合力。想象一下,力的合成就像是一个物理世界的编排者,它需要考虑各个力的方向和大小,来确定最终的作用效果。

在实际应用中,力的合成有着广泛的应用场景。例如,在工程设计中,工程师需要计算建筑物在不同载荷下的受力情况,以确保其结构的安全性和稳定性。在运动学中,运动员需要通过合理的动作来最大化地利用身体的力量,从而提高运动表现。这些应用场景都需要精确地计算和理解力的合成原理。

# 三、相似之处:优化与协调

调度算法与力的合成:一场看不见的较量

尽管调度算法和力的合成看似来自不同的领域,但它们在优化和协调方面有着惊人的相似之处。首先,两者都需要考虑多个因素来做出最优决策。在调度算法中,需要考虑任务的优先级、资源的可用性等;而在力的合成中,则需要考虑各个力的方向和大小。其次,两者都需要通过某种方式来合并多个因素的影响,以达到最优的结果。在调度算法中,通过选择合适的算法来合并任务;而在力的合成中,则通过矢量加法来合并各个力。

此外,两者都强调了优化的重要性。在调度算法中,优化的目标是提高系统的效率和性能;而在力的合成中,则是确保物体能够稳定地承受各种载荷。这种优化的思想贯穿于两者的核心理念之中,使得它们在各自的领域中发挥着不可替代的作用。

# 四、应用场景与实际案例

调度算法与力的合成:一场看不见的较量

调度算法与力的合成:一场看不见的较量

在实际应用中,调度算法和力的合成都有着广泛的应用场景。例如,在计算机系统中,调度算法可以用于优化任务的执行顺序,从而提高系统的整体性能;而在工程设计中,力的合成可以用于计算建筑物在不同载荷下的受力情况,以确保其结构的安全性和稳定性。这些应用场景不仅展示了它们在各自领域的独特价值,也体现了它们在优化和协调方面的相似之处。

# 五、未来展望

随着科技的发展,调度算法和力的合成将继续发挥着重要的作用。在未来,我们可以期待看到更多创新的应用场景和解决方案。例如,在智能交通系统中,调度算法可以用于优化交通流量管理,减少拥堵和事故;而在机器人技术中,力的合成可以用于提高机器人的运动精度和稳定性。这些应用将进一步推动这两个领域的进步和发展。

调度算法与力的合成:一场看不见的较量

总之,调度算法和力的合成虽然来自不同的领域,但它们在优化和协调方面有着惊人的相似之处。通过深入研究和应用这些原理,我们可以更好地理解和解决实际问题,推动科技的进步和发展。